Either way, the electronic door lock is configured to begin the motor-driven actuator just when it has actually received the appropriate electronic input. Each method of locking has pros and cons. Physical secrets, such as metal secrets, key cards or portable remotes, can be lost or damaged, while mathematical essential codes can be forgotten (or discovered and remembered by the wrong individual).

Power failures are problematic for purely electronic door locks, causing them to remain locked or unlocked up until the electrical energy has been brought back. On most electronic door locks, you'll discover some combination of physical and electronic locking control on the exact same door. For example, you may have a physical key for setup and emergency situation backup, however use the remote or keypad to lock and open the door on a day-to-day basis.

With an advanced automatic system, electronic door locks can be managed and kept an eye on remotely. When it comes to vehicles, this means that you can lock and open the doors (or pop here the trunk, or start the engine) while still some range away from the car. With houses or organizations, this can indicate much more.

Remote monitoring apps can enable you to use your smartphone to see if there are any unlocked doors, and lock them from throughout the world. In the worst case, you can open your door remotely for fast, non-destructive access to fire and authorities workers if an emergency occurs when you're away from home.

Learn more about how keypad locks work and their benefits. Instead of a secret, this type of lock system needs a mathematical code to grant entry to a facility or Informative post home. The code is punched in by users through a mathematical pad, similar to those on a basic calculator. If the appropriate code is entered, the door lock or deadbolt need to launch.

Some keypad locks have an integrated security function that keeps the door locked for a set quantity of time (generally 10 to 15 minutes) after a number of inaccurate efforts to go into the code. There are many benefits to selecting this type of keyless lock over conventional locking systems. The biggest benefit is convenience.

There's no need to bring them around, keep an eye on copies and spares, or alter locks when a secret is taken or lost. Kids, guests and company can be offered their own code or a short-term code, rather than a secret. Keypad locks have a various hardware style than other types of locks.
